Abstract
Although the clinical manifestations and neuropathological signs of multipl e sclerosis (MS) have been known for a century, the cause of this disease h as not yet been determined. The epidemiological studies indicate that MS is of multifactorial etiology, including both environmental and inherited (ge netic predisposition) factors. The role of the HLA system in genetic predis position to MS has been known since the 1970s. As a result of the progress made in human genetics, it is now possible to study genetic predisposition to MS. (C) 2000 Editions scientifiques et medicales Elsevier SAS.
